Contingency Fees

Financial challenges are often faced by people who have been diagnosed with mesothelioma, or those whose loved ones have passed away from the disease. The money from a mesothelioma suit will help victims pay medical bills and support their families. It's crucial to work with an attorney who understands the costs of these cases and doesn't charge victims for hourly fees.

Top mesothelioma lawyers operate on the basis of contingency, meaning that they only receive payment if their clients win the case through a settlement or verdict. This allows them to concentrate on the case, not worrying about how they will pay for it. They also recognize that their clients are suffering enough financial strain So they won't ask clients to take on a huge risk.

Asbestos lawyers typically charge a contingency cost of between 33-40 percent of the total amount owed. This is a fair price for the work done by mesothelioma lawyers on behalf of clients. This allows clients to avoid out-of-pocket costs and lets them focus on their health and their family.

National Firms

National firms give clients peace of peace of mind throughout the legal process. They can handle all the legal issues such as analyzing your asbestos exposure and filing a claim within your state. If you must travel to a deposition or another meeting they will cover the cost.

Lawyers working for national firms are licensed to practice law in all 50 states. They can file your suit in the state that has the highest potential for payout. They are also well-versed in the laws and regulations of each state, including statutes of limitation.

Mesothelioma lawyers are committed to bringing accountable businesses that expose workers to asbestos. These firms' asbestos attorneys employ their negotiation and legal skills in order to obtain compensation for their clients. They assist their clients in recovering compensation to pay for medical bills, lost income, and other expenses.

Asbestos victims can also apply to trust funds to receive financial assistance. There are over 62 asbestos trust funds with a total value of $25 billion. Experienced mesothelioma attorneys know how to make the most of the value of these claims. They may be able get trust fund awards that exceed the amount of compensation that comes from the lawsuit.

Asbestos victims, and their families are entitled to financial compensation for treatment and other costs. Mesothelioma lawyers can bring an individual injury or wrongful death lawsuit in order to obtain compensation. These lawsuits can cover future and past medical expenses, lost wages, funeral costs as well as discomfort and pain.

Lawyers may also make trust fund claims on behalf of mesothelioma sufferers. Asbestos companies that have been impacted by numerous lawsuits may be required to organize and create trust funds for asbestos victims. These trusts are financed by the assets of the company and are intended to compensate asbestos victims outside of court.
